You mean to say that with all the fortunes made in Hollywood there's not enough money to keep open the Motion Picture & Television Fund's hospital and nursing home in Woodland Hills? Guess so. Financial problems will result in the closing of the facility by year's end. About 100 patients will be relocated to area nursing homes, and 300 or so workers are losing their jobs. Unbelievable.
